Court News

LISBON — Chelsea Renee Faloba, 31, East Washington Street, Lisbon, pleaded guilty in Common Pleas Court to obstructing official business, assault and resisting arrest.

On May 1, Faloba was at Pembrooke Drive, Salem, where she attacked Heidi M. Wilhelm, grabbing her by the hair, punching her in the face and back and scratching her neck and arms. She then interfered with her own arrest by Perry Township detective Jordan Reynolds, creating a risk of harm to Reynolds while doing so.

Faloba is facing up to 21 months in prison and a fine of $4,250. Sentencing was set for March 2.

Jennifer N. Whaley, 38, Maplewood Drive, Columbiana, pleaded guilty to possession of drugs, a fifth-degree felony, for having lorazepam on Jan. 10. Sentencing was set for Feb. 3. Whaley faces up to a year in prison and a $2,500 fine.
